最新消息: 电脑我帮您提供丰富的电脑知识,编程学习,软件下载,win7系统下载。

权限被拒绝安装npm

IT培训 admin 8浏览 0评论

权限被拒绝安装npm

所以今天是星期一,这是肯定的。我所做的allllllll是运行命令$ sudo rm -r node_modules/ package-lock.json,然后从那里运行命令$ npm i重新安装依赖项。从那里我得到一个错误,说我没有权限:

npm ERR! path /Users/c.francia/Desktop/application/app/node_modules/@types
npm ERR! code EACCES
npm ERR! errno -13
npm ERR! syscall access
npm ERR!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'
npm ERR!  [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'] {
npm ERR!   stack: "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'",
npm ERR!   errno: -13,
npm ERR!   code: 'EACCES',
npm ERR!   syscall: 'access',
npm ERR!   path: '/Users/c.francia/Desktop/application/app/node_modules/@types'
npm ERR! }

我尝试了建议的命令sudo chown -R $(whoami) ~/.npm并被广泛接受的here,也尝试了建议的$ sudo chown -R $USER /usr/local/lib/node_modules here,但之前我遇到此错误,但是第一个解决方案为我解决了该错误。因此,我不知道删除node_modules和package-lock.json文件后发生了什么变化]

所以今天是星期一,这是肯定的。我所做的allllllll是运行命令$ sudo rm -r node_modules / package-lock.json,然后从那里开始运行命令$ npm i以重新安装...

回答如下:

如果第一个解决方案适合您,则.npm中的权限未正确设置。现在您的权限已解决,请尝试避免将来再将sudonpm命令一起使用。

权限被拒绝安装npm

所以今天是星期一,这是肯定的。我所做的allllllll是运行命令$ sudo rm -r node_modules/ package-lock.json,然后从那里运行命令$ npm i重新安装依赖项。从那里我得到一个错误,说我没有权限:

npm ERR! path /Users/c.francia/Desktop/application/app/node_modules/@types
npm ERR! code EACCES
npm ERR! errno -13
npm ERR! syscall access
npm ERR!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'
npm ERR!  [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'] {
npm ERR!   stack: "Error: EACCES: permission denied, access '/Users/c.francia/Desktop/application/app/node_modules/@types'",
npm ERR!   errno: -13,
npm ERR!   code: 'EACCES',
npm ERR!   syscall: 'access',
npm ERR!   path: '/Users/c.francia/Desktop/application/app/node_modules/@types'
npm ERR! }

我尝试了建议的命令sudo chown -R $(whoami) ~/.npm并被广泛接受的here,也尝试了建议的$ sudo chown -R $USER /usr/local/lib/node_modules here,但之前我遇到此错误,但是第一个解决方案为我解决了该错误。因此,我不知道删除node_modules和package-lock.json文件后发生了什么变化]

所以今天是星期一,这是肯定的。我所做的allllllll是运行命令$ sudo rm -r node_modules / package-lock.json,然后从那里开始运行命令$ npm i以重新安装...

回答如下:

如果第一个解决方案适合您,则.npm中的权限未正确设置。现在您的权限已解决,请尝试避免将来再将sudonpm命令一起使用。

与本文相关的文章

发布评论

评论列表 (0)

  1. 暂无评论